Can blood from a crime scene be analyzed if it is diluted by rainwater?

It depends on the degree of dilution, represented by the amount of rain water in which the blood was diluted. If the amount of water containing the blood is small, chances are that the blood can be analized. Moreover, the blood must be contained in a puddle, not in a running rain water, because the dilution would become very weak, thus difficulting any precise analisys, which would be essential in terms of forensic issues. It depends also on the intensity of the rain. Heavy ones can take the blood droplets very far away. In fact, blood is not diluted by the running rain water, but it will be sparsely dissolved in water. Only when the rain stops, if it was not a heavy one, investigators could try to find blood vestige around. However, technically there are many methods used today to find tiny vestige of blood which could last for years on that place.
